Point de vue – Le Port de Saint-Seurin-d'Uzet
The Port of Saint-Seurin-d'Uzet is a small fishing port, which was an active center for sturgeon fishing and the production of caviar.
Today, mainly a marina that can accommodate boats under 8 meters and overlooking the Gironde estuary with the tides, crossing the reed bed.
Place with games and picnic areas, hosting a camper van area and a small museum on the economic activity of the village yesterday and today, in premises of the old campsite (closed).
Its management is granted to the municipality by the Grand Port Maritime de Bordeaux.
